Abstract
We consider multirate sampled-data systems with a single input sampling period and multiple output sampling periods that are integer multiples of the input sampling period. We modify the Chow-Willsky approach to obtain a residual generator design for this class of multirate systems. We derive conditions for the existence of residual generators that guarantees fault detection and disturbance rejection. We also derive conditions of the existence of a structured residual generator. An example is presented to illustrate our approach
